Produktbeschreibung
Mark Baxter, the main character, an ex-Navy Seal, DEA operative, retired, yet still young in his forties. His current status explained in the story. Mark, living at Lake Tahoe, Nevada, an avid hiker and outdoorsman with no job is on one of his mountain hikes/climbs in the Sierra Nevada Mountains when he witnesses the crash of an aircraft in his vicinity. He hurries to the site to discover the contents of the aircraft. The contents are three deceased individuals and a cache of cocaine and lots of cash. Mark weighs morality versus desire/need of what is before him. Desire and need wins out. From this point on, the story develops with several other characters. Lots of adventure, suspense, romance with his lover. Story takes place in Lake Tahoe, Latin America and the Orient. All of the places Mark in his career with the DEA and the Navy Seals is familiar. The FBI, the DEA, and of course, the local authorities get involved, especially a detective out of Lake Tahoe who becomes an important character and integral part of the story. It is a story of chase and escape. Colorful descriptions of places and situations with a surprise ending. The narrative is purely fictional. The characters wholly fictional. Autorenporträt
Born in West Virginia on the Western Edge of the Appalachian Mountains. Graduated high school. Entered the military, US Air Force, during the Korean War. Honorably discharged after four years, then entered college. West Virginia University. Graduated with a degree in business administration. Moved to California, where I lived for more than forty years. Ten in Nevada. Married twice. Three children with first wife. Now divorced. Have lived on the western slope, at the top of, (South Lake Tahoe) and on the eastern slope of the Sierra Nevada Mountains for thirty of the forty years in California/Nevada. Have been on top of nearly every mountain within fifty miles of Lake Tahoe. The San Gabriel Mountains in Southern California and the Santa Ynez Mountains in central California. Have travelled to Europe, Africa, Caribbean. Lived in Hawaii on the island of Maui for a short time. Have had many career starts and stops after college. In later years of my life, I was a snowbird, wintering in the California desert while summering in northern Idaho, where I now live. In summation, I am a healthy octogenarian, still hiking and climbing mountains wherever I find them.
